Digital bioethics: exploring an emerging field

Digital Bioethics integrates advanced data science methods into bioethics, enhancing research and clinical applications. This emerging field requires careful definition and comparison with related disciplines to navigate its potential and challenges.
Area of Science:
- Bioethics
- Data Science
- Digital Humanities
Background:
- Bioethics has historically integrated social science methods, expanding its scope.
- A new trend involves incorporating advanced data science methods into bioethics for tasks like online data analysis and clinical ethics support.
Purpose of the Study:
- To explore the emerging field of Digital Bioethics.
- To analyze the relationship between topics and methods in Digital Bioethics.
- To advocate for a methods-based definition of Digital Bioethics.
Main Methods:
- Analysis of the relationship between topics and methods in Digital Bioethics.
- Comparison with four related academic fields: Digital Humanities, Experimental Philosophical Bioethics, computational medicine, and digitised biology.
- Discussion of the use of Artificial Intelligence (AI) in healthcare and its implications for bioethics.
Main Results:
- Digital Bioethics presents unique opportunities and challenges.
- Defining Digital Bioethics involves trade-offs but can foster field support.
- Comparative analysis with related fields offers insights for developing Digital Bioethics.
Conclusions:
- Digital Bioethics requires critical assessment and development to realize its full potential.
- Recommendations are provided for advancing bioethical research and argument through Digital Bioethics.
- Critical reflection on AI methods in bioethics is crucial for ethical oversight in AI-driven healthcare.
